Substance Abuse Treatment for Male - Alcohol and Drug Treatment Programs - Deerfield, MI.

The Male gender has plenty of gender-specific drug rehab facilities to choose from, such as regular and intensive outpatient, inpatient programs and sober living options. Typically male clients tend to make it to rehab in the later in the more severe stages of their addiction and may require more intensive treatment and intervention. Residential inpatient drug treatment facilities for males which provide a strong system of support from peers and treatment staff is going to be very beneficial because the later stages of addiction require full engagement with the treatment process. Detoxification is the first step, and may call for medical intervention in some instances, particularly if the male client is suffering with physical health problems resulting from their substance abuse. Outpatient therapy typically won't offer this, but inpatient facilities typically offer a vast assortment of detoxification services to assist male-gender clients through withdrawal as safely and as comfortably as possible.

Male clients receiving treatment in Deerfield commonly have very specific issues they need to work on, challenges having to do with gender and their role as males in their household and in society. Treatment that is targeted to address issues that males face includes counseling and therapies to improve self-esteem, improve one's ability to cope with life stresses, anger management, etc. There may even be instances where male clients have been victims of physical or sexual abuse, and may not feel comfortable revealing this in a co-ed rehab setting.
